✨ Starting the new year in Isehara ✨
We’re kicking off 2026 by highlighting Diversity — one of the 5 key components of the World Campus program.
In Isehara, diversity came to life through the people we met — local Rotary Clubs, city officials (and the Mayor!), high school students, host families, and the many community members and volunteers who welcomed us so warmly and helped us feel at home. We visited the Nissan Heritage Collection, had general discussions with city staff, and even spoke with a priest at Oyama Afuri Shrine, a sacred mountain shrine that has protected the Kanto region and heard people’s wishes since ancient times.
At a local festival organized by the Isehara Rotary Club, students and locals came together to share culture, food, and conversation. The Isehara Heisei Rotary Club introduced us to traditional Japanese culture too — including the spinning top, Oyama koma, Isehara is known for.
